Understanding Cornstarch Containers


Cornstarch containers are derived from the starch found in corn kernels. During processing, the starch is synthesized into a polymer that can be molded into various shapes, allowing for the production of durable and functional containers. Unlike conventional plastic, which can take hundreds of years to decompose, cornstarch containers break down within a few months under the right conditions, thus significantly reducing waste in landfills.


Advantages of Cornstarch Containers


1. Biodegradability One of the most significant advantages of cornstarch containers is their ability to decompose naturally. These containers can break down into non-toxic organic matter when disposed of properly. This characteristic helps mitigate plastic pollution, which poses a severe threat to wildlife and ecosystems.


2. Renewable Resource Corn is a renewable resource, unlike petroleum-based plastics. By using cornstarch, industries can help reduce dependency on fossil fuels, thereby contributing to a more sustainable future. The agricultural practices associated with corn cultivation can also promote soil health and biodiversity if managed responsibly.


3. Versatility Cornstarch containers are available in various forms, including cups, plates, clamshells, and bags. This versatility makes them suitable for a myriad of applications, ranging from food service in restaurants and catering events to packaging for cosmetics and household products.

4. Heat Resistance While many biodegradable containers struggle with heat, cornstarch containers can withstand certain temperatures, making them suitable for both hot and cold food items. This property ensures practicality across different culinary settings without compromising food integrity.


Applications in Different Sectors


The food industry has been one of the largest adopters of cornstarch containers, with many restaurants and cafes transitioning to these eco-friendly alternatives. Single-use items, such as takeout containers and utensils, have contributed significantly to plastic waste, but with cornstarch options, businesses can attract environmentally conscious consumers while maintaining quality service.


Moreover, in the retail sector, cornstarch bags offer a sustainable solution for customers looking to reduce their environmental impact during shopping. With consumers increasingly aware of their purchasing choices, incorporating cornstarch packaging can enhance a brand's image and appeal to eco-friendly values.


Additionally, the cosmetics industry is discovering the benefits of cornstarch containers for packaging products. From powders to creams, using biodegradable containers can reassure consumers that their beauty routines do not have to harm the planet.


Challenges and Future Prospects


Despite the myriad advantages, cornstarch containers do face challenges, particularly concerning their durability and cost when compared to conventional plastic. Additionally, proper industrial composting facilities are necessary to ensure they break down effectively. However, as technology progresses and consumer demand for sustainable options grows, these challenges are gradually being addressed.
